Lost Planet Map-Pack Now Available For Purchase

Capcom has announced the first paid map-pack for Lost Planet: Condition Zero. It will be available for download on the Xbox Live Marketplace from March 9th (or as close to) for 400 points.
The first pack contains two new multiplayer levels:
Radar Field: featuring close-quarters combat in a radar dish construction zone.
Island 902: a Pacific battlefield, featuring lots of islands, bridges, and underground areas.
They've also announced that the level Battleground, offered 'exclusively' to the limited edition of the game, will also be available soon as a free download for all players.
